Java IOUtils.copy()的使用
流之间复制
一般流程
File file1 = new File(fileName1);
File file2 = new File(fileName2);
InputStream inputStream =new FileInputStream(file1);
byte[] byteArr= new byte[1024];
while(inputStream.read()){
inputStream.read(byteArr);
}
OutputStream outputStream = new FileOutputStream(file2);
outputStream.write(byteArr);
IOUtils.copy()
方法
File file1 = new File(fileName1);
File file2 = new File(fileName2);
InputStream inputStream = new FileInputStream(file1);
OutputStream outputStream = new FileOutputStream(file2);
IOUtils.copy(inputStream,outputStream);